Keith Packard 82612045e1 randr: Add per-crtc pixmaps
This adds new driver hooks to allocate scanout pixmaps and
changes the mode setting APIs to pass the new scanout pixmaps
along from DIX. DIX is responsible for reference counting the pixmaps
by tracking them through RRCrtcNotify.

#include "randrstr.h"
#include "xace.h"
int
ProcRRQueryScanoutPixmaps (ClientPtr client)
{
REQUEST(xRRQueryScanoutPixmapsReq);
xRRQueryScanoutPixmapsReply rep;
RRScanoutPixmapInfo *info;
xRRScanoutPixmapInfo *x_info;
int n_info;
int rc;
DrawablePtr drawable;
ScreenPtr screen;
rrScrPrivPtr screen_priv;
int n, s;
REQUEST_SIZE_MATCH(xRRQueryScanoutPixmapsReq);
rc = dixLookupDrawable(&drawable, stuff->drawable, client, 0, DixGetAttrAccess);
if (rc != Success) {
client->errorValue = stuff->drawable;
return rc;
}
screen = drawable->pScreen;
screen_priv = rrGetScrPriv(screen);
rep.type = X_Reply;
/* rep.status has already been filled in */
rep.length = 0;
rep.sequenceNumber = client->sequence;
info = RRQueryScanoutPixmapInfo(screen, &n_info);
x_info = calloc(n_info, sizeof (xRRScanoutPixmapInfo));
if (n_info && !x_info)
return BadAlloc;
rep.length += (n_info * sizeof (xRRScanoutPixmapInfo)) >> 2;
if (client->swapped) {
swaps(&rep.sequenceNumber, n);
swapl(&rep.length, n);
}
for (s = 0; s < n_info; s++) {
x_info[s].format = info[s].format->id;
x_info[s].maxWidth = info[s].maxWidth;
x_info[s].maxHeight = info[s].maxHeight;
x_info[s].rotations = info[s].rotations;
if (client->swapped) {
swapl(&x_info[s].format, n);
swaps(&x_info[s].maxWidth, n);
swaps(&x_info[s].maxHeight, n);
swaps(&x_info[s].rotations, n);
}
}
WriteToClient(client, sizeof(rep), (char *)&rep);
if (n_info)
WriteToClient(client, n_info * sizeof (xRRScanoutPixmapInfo),
(char *) x_info);
return Success;
}
int
ProcRRCreateScanoutPixmap (ClientPtr client)
{
REQUEST(xRRCreateScanoutPixmapReq);
int rc;
DrawablePtr drawable;
ScreenPtr screen;
rrScrPrivPtr screen_priv;
PixmapPtr pixmap;
int n_info;
RRScanoutPixmapInfo *info;
int s;
REQUEST_SIZE_MATCH(xRRCreateScanoutPixmapReq);
client->errorValue = stuff->pid;
LEGAL_NEW_RESOURCE(stuff->pid, client);
rc = dixLookupDrawable(&drawable, stuff->drawable, client, 0, DixGetAttrAccess);
if (rc != Success) {
client->errorValue = stuff->drawable;
return rc;
}
screen = drawable->pScreen;
screen_priv = rrGetScrPriv(screen);
if (!screen_priv)
return BadValue;
info = RRQueryScanoutPixmapInfo(screen, &n_info);
for (s = 0; s < n_info; s++) {
if (info[s].format->id == stuff->format)
break;
}
if (s == n_info || !screen_priv->rrCreateScanoutPixmap) {
client->errorValue = stuff->format;
return BadValue;
}
info = &info[s];
if (!stuff->width || stuff->width > info->maxWidth) {
client->errorValue = stuff->width;
return BadValue;
}
if (!stuff->height || stuff->height > info->maxHeight) {
client->errorValue = stuff->height;
return BadValue;
}
if ((stuff->rotations & info->rotations) != stuff->rotations) {
client->errorValue = stuff->rotations;
return BadValue;
}
pixmap = screen_priv->rrCreateScanoutPixmap (screen,
stuff->width, stuff->height,
info->depth,
stuff->rotations,
info->format);
if (!pixmap)
return BadAlloc;
pixmap->drawable.serialNumber = NEXT_SERIAL_NUMBER;
pixmap->drawable.id = stuff->pid;
rc = XaceHook(XACE_RESOURCE_ACCESS, client, stuff->pid, RT_PIXMAP,
pixmap, RT_NONE, NULL, DixCreateAccess);
if (rc != Success) {
screen->DestroyPixmap(pixmap);
return rc;
}
if (!AddResource(stuff->pid, RT_PIXMAP, pixmap))
return BadAlloc;
return Success;
}
